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of labeling devices, in particular to a rotary labeling device.
Background
In the production of products, labels are often applied to the cylindrical side walls of the cans. Before labeling, labels are usually continuously pre-adhered on a recovery belt, the recovery belt adhered with the labels is sent to a labeling device through a label feeding mechanism, and the recovery belt is rolled up for recovery after the labels are peeled off. The existing labeling device has poor label pressing effect, is difficult to stably adhere the label on the container tank, is easy to peel off and even fall off, and is difficult to meet actual production requirements.

After the technical scheme is adopted, the utility model has the following beneficial effects: when the device is used, firstly, the container on the conveyor belt is guided into the space between the adjacent installation rollers through the material guide plate, and the container between the two installation rollers is driven to move through the rotation of the turntable; then, the recycling belt with the labels is sent into the labeling device through a label feeding mechanism (the existing label feeding mechanism can be adopted, not shown in the drawing), the front end of the labels and the recycling belt can be stripped in the process of feeding the labels due to the large steering angle of the recycling belt at the inner end part of the separating plate, and when the container is moved to the stripped labels, the front end of the labels are pre-adhered to the side wall of the container; then, the container can further moves along with the turntable until the pressing roller is tightly pressed on the outer side of the label, and the pressing roller drives the container can to rotate between the two mounting rollers to tightly attach the label; finally, the container tank further moves along with the turntable, and under the action of the conveyor belt, the container tank after labeling can be outwards conveyed, and the label can be tightly pressed by the pressing roller and the mounting roller, so that the label is tightly adhered to the outer wall of the container tank, the labeling speed is high, and the using effect is good.

Referring to fig. 1 to 2, a rotary labeling device includes a workbench 1, a conveyor belt 2, a mounting assembly 3 and a rolling assembly 4; the upper end of the workbench 1 is provided with a yielding groove 10, and the conveyor belt 2 is arranged in the yielding groove 10 in a penetrating manner; the mounting assembly 3 comprises a turntable 30, a rotating shaft 31 and a feeding motor 32; the lower end of the rotating shaft 31 is rotationally connected with the workbench 1, the upper end of the rotating shaft 31 is fixedly connected with the center of the turntable 30, and the output shaft of the feeding motor 32 is fixedly connected with the rotating shaft 31; a plurality of accommodating grooves 300 are formed in the outer edge of the turntable 30 at intervals; a plurality of installation rollers 33 are rotatably installed on the turntable 30 between adjacent receiving grooves 300; the rolling assembly 4 comprises a pressing roller 40 and a rolling motor 41; the pressing roller 40 is rotatably arranged at the upper end of the workbench 1, and an output shaft of the rolling motor 41 is fixedly connected with the pressing roller 40; the outer edge of the turntable 30 is positioned above one side of the conveyor belt 2, a material guide plate 11 is arranged on the workbench 1 at the other side of the conveyor belt 2, and the container cans 5 on the conveyor belt 2 are guided between the adjacent mounting rollers 33 through the material guide plate 11; a separating plate 12 is fixed at the upper end of the workbench 1 between the material guiding plate 11 and the pressing roller 40, the recovery belt 6 is wound on two sides of the separating plate 12, one end of the peeled label 60 is pre-adhered to the outer wall of the container tank 5, the recovery belt 6 adhered with the label 60 is sent into the labeling device by adopting the existing label feeding mechanism (not shown in the figure), the recovery belt 6 peeled with the label 60 is collected, and the specific structure of the label feeding mechanism is not repeated one by one; the turntable 30 and the pressing roller 40 are oppositely arranged at two sides of the conveyor belt 2, and the pressing roller 40 drives the container tank 5 to rotate between the two mounting rollers 33 to tightly attach the label 60.
As shown in fig. 1, a discharging baffle 13 for limiting lateral movement of the container tank 5 is arranged on one side of the discharging end of the conveyor belt 2; the material guide plate 11 and the material discharge baffle 13 are respectively positioned at two sides of the pressing roller 40.
As shown in fig. 1, the side walls of the material guiding plate 11 and the material discharging baffle 13 near one end of the pressing roller 40 are respectively provided with a first cambered surface 110 and a second cambered surface 130; the first cambered surface 110 and the second cambered surface 130 are both positioned at one side close to the container tank 5, and a conveying channel of the container tank 5 is formed between the first cambered surface 110, the second cambered surface 130 and the turntable 30.
As shown in fig. 1, the outer wall of the installation roller 33 is sleeved and fixed with a first rubber ring 330, and the outer wall of the pressing roller 40 is sleeved and fixed with a second rubber ring 400.
As shown in fig. 1, the outer sides of the conveyor belt 2 at both sides of the turntable 30 are provided with side plates 7 for restricting lateral movement of the cans 5.
